Chuck DidntSuckChuck DidntSuck
Have you ever checked out Amano Pizza yet? I know they have multiple locations, I visited the South Amboy spot. Got a cheese pie and a cheesesteak. The staff was super friendly and helpful and the restaurant had ample seating and was clean. Was with my girlfriend (who doesn’t like onions) so I got the steak “without”. Ribeye, Cooper sharp cheese, and a seeded semolina roll. The roll was toasted but I don’t think it needed to be, seemed like it would have been an even more solid roll without the toasting. I know they get them fresh daily from a bakery in Staten Island. Cooper Sharp is simply the best and ribeye is obviously what we’re looking for here. It was more chopped than I personally prefer, but that’s just a preference thing. The flavor was great. One of the better pizzas I’ve had in quite a while. They use Grande cheese which is the first thing that makes me happy when getting pizza. The crust was thin and crispy and there was a nice little bit of char on the bottom. I could have eaten this pizza all day long. I’d definitely go back and check out some other stuff from Amano, and get another cheese pie 😊. Certainly … Didn’t Suck!
